Understanding Contingency Fee Structure
When you’re considering hiring a Glendale personal injury attorney, understanding the contingency fee structure is crucial, as it directly affects how much you’ll pay for legal representation.
A contingency fee arrangement means that you won’t pay any upfront costs or hourly fees. Instead, your attorney’s payment is contingent upon winning your case. This fee structure is typically a percentage of the settlement or award you receive.
Contingency fee percentages vary across the personal injury industry, and your attorney should explain the exact percentage that applies to your case clearly before you sign a fee agreement this way there are no surprises about what you’ll take home from a settlement or award. Costs Associated With Hiring a Glendale Personal Injury Lawyer
Hiring an attorney can be a significant investment, and understanding the potential costs involved is crucial for effective financial planning. The expenses associated with legal representation can vary widely depending on the complexity of your case, the attorney’s experience, and the region in which you live.
Here’s a breakdown of common costs you might encounter across the industry, along with how Babaians Law Firm specifically approaches each one:
- Contingency fees: The most common fee arrangement in personal injury cases. The lawyer takes an agreed-upon percentage of the settlement or court award, which is disclosed to you in writing up front. This percentage may vary depending on the complexity of the case and whether it goes to trial.
- Court costs and expenses: In addition to the contingency fee, there may be other costs associated with your case, such as filing fees, costs for obtaining medical records, expert witness fees, and court reporter fees. Factors that May Affect the Average Cost of a Glendale Personal Injury Lawyer
While personal injury lawyers typically work on a contingency fee basis, meaning you only pay if you receive a settlement or award, several factors can still affect the overall cost of your legal representation.
- Complexity of the case: Even on a contingency basis, more complex cases that require extensive investigation, expert testimony, or litigation can result in higher overall costs. These cases may also involve a different contingency percentage depending on the work required.
- Experience of the lawyer: Lawyers with more experience or a strong reputation in personal injury law may structure their fees differently based on their expertise and track record of success.
- Case duration: The length of time it takes to resolve your case can impact the total costs. Longer cases, especially those that go to trial, often require more resources.
- Costs and expenses: While the contingency fee covers the lawyer’s services, there may be additional costs, such as filing fees, costs for obtaining medical records, and fees for expert witnesses. These expenses are usually deducted from your settlement, but they can vary depending on the case.
- Settlement versus trial: Cases that settle out of court typically incur fewer costs compared to those that go to trial.
Even though the contingency fee structure helps minimize upfront costs, understanding these factors will help you anticipate the potential expenses involved in your personal injury case.

Are case expenses like expert witness fees separate from the attorney's fee?
Yes, generally. Costs such as expert witness fees, medical record retrieval, and court filing fees are typically handled separately from the attorney’s percentage fee and are usually deducted from your settlement rather than billed to you directly out of pocket.
